Hajime Yano is a scholar working on Astronomy and Astrophysics, Aerospace Engineering and Ecology. According to data from OpenAlex, Hajime Yano has authored 175 papers receiving a total of 2.0k indexed citations (citations by other indexed papers that have themselves been cited), including 153 papers in Astronomy and Astrophysics, 56 papers in Aerospace Engineering and 19 papers in Ecology. Recurrent topics in Hajime Yano's work include Astro and Planetary Science (137 papers), Planetary Science and Exploration (124 papers) and Space Satellite Systems and Control (22 papers). Hajime Yano is often cited by papers focused on Astro and Planetary Science (137 papers), Planetary Science and Exploration (124 papers) and Space Satellite Systems and Control (22 papers). Hajime Yano collaborates with scholars based in Japan, United States and United Kingdom. Hajime Yano's co-authors include Sunao Hasegawa, Shinsuke Abe, Masateru Ishiguro, Hideaki Miyamoto, O. S. Barnouin, J. Saito, Daniel J. Scheeres, T. Noguchi, M. J. Burchell and Jun’ichiro Kawaguchi and has published in prestigious journals such as Science, SHILAP Revista de lepidopterología and Applied Physics Letters.
